5-Day Pondicherry Family Friendly Itinerary

Saturday, December 23: Exploring French Quarter

In the morning, start your trip by visiting the beautiful French Quarter of Pondicherry. Take a leisurely stroll along the charming streets lined with colonial-era buildings, colorful houses, and quaint cafes. Explore the French architecture and indulge in delicious pastries at local bakeries. In the afternoon, visit the iconic Promenade Beach and enjoy the scenic views of the Bay of Bengal. In the evening, head to Bharathi Park, a tranquil green space ideal for a family picnic.

  • French Quarter: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Promenade Beach: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Bharathi Park: Free, 1-2 hours

Sunday, December 24: Auroville and Aurobindo Ashram

Embark on a spiritual journey by visiting Auroville, an experimental township. Explore the Matrimandir, an architectural marvel and meditation space. In the afternoon, visit the Aurobindo Ashram, founded by Sri Aurobindo and known for its peaceful atmosphere. Attend a meditation session or explore the ashram's library. As the evening approaches, explore the serene Matri Mandir Gardens and enjoy a serene walk amidst nature.

  • Auroville: Free, 3-4 hours
  • Aurobindo Ashram: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Matri Mandir Gardens: Free, 1-2 hours

Monday, December 25: Chunnambar Boat House and Paradise Beach

Relax and unwind at Chunnambar Boat House, located along the backwaters of Pondicherry. Take a boat ride to Paradise Beach and spend the morning enjoying the pristine sandy shores and turquoise waters. Engage in water sports activities or simply lounge under the sun. In the afternoon, explore the mangrove forests and indulge in a picnic amidst nature's beauty. Wrap up the day with a mesmerizing boat ride along the backwaters.

  • Chunnambar Boat House: INR 300 per person (boat ride), 3-4 hours
  • Paradise Beach: Free, 3-4 hours
  • Mangrove Forests: Free, 1-2 hours

Tuesday, December 26: Pondicherry Museum and Shopping

Start the day by exploring the Pondicherry Museum, showcasing a collection of archaeological findings, sculptures, and artifacts. Gain insights into the rich history and cultural heritage of the region. In the afternoon, indulge in some shopping at Mission Street and MG Road, known for their boutique stores offering handicrafts, clothing, and souvenirs. In the evening, take a pleasant walk along the Promenade to admire the beautiful French architecture.

  • Pondicherry Museum: INR 10 per person, 2-3 hours
  • Mission Street and MG Road Shopping: Varies, 2-3 hours
  • Promenade: Free, 1-2 hours

Wednesday, December 27: Chunnambar Backwaters and Arikamedu

Explore the serene Chunnambar Backwaters and embark on a houseboat or kayak ride along the peaceful canals. Enjoy the scenic beauty and spot migratory birds. In the afternoon, visit Arikamedu, an ancient archaeological site known for its Roman trade connections. Discover the remnants of a Roman settlement and immerse yourself in history. Indulge in a traditional South Indian meal at a local eatery. End the day with a visit to the Pondicherry Botanical Garden and savor the tranquility.

  • Chunnambar Backwaters: INR 1,000 per person (houseboat ride), 3-4 hours
  • Arikamedu: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Pondicherry Botanical Garden: INR 20 per person, 1-2 hours
